Senate Democrats blocked cryptocurrency regulation legislation, demanding stricter ethics safeguards to limit President Trump's profits from crypto while he is in office. Despite some concessions from Trump, the bill failed to gain the 60 votes needed to advance, stalling a significant regulatory effort in the US crypto market.
